Global ETFs vs. International ETFs: Which is Right for You?
When it comes to investing, Exchange-Traded Funds (ETFs) offer a flexible way to allocate your portfolio. Nevertheless, choosing between US and Canadian ETFs can be confusing. Both present a wide range of investment options, but there are some key differences to consider. Initially, US ETFs typically have higher assets under management (AUM) and may offer more extensive coverage of international markets. Canadian ETFs, on the other hand, are generally known for their reduced expense ratios and solid performance in certain industries. Ultimately, the best choice for you will depend on your specific financial goals, risk tolerance, and financial situation.
